What the hell is Evil?

April 7, 2008 on 5:19 am | In Philosomaphy, Values | 1 Comment

I’ve thought a bit about this lately. The best definition I have so far is that evil is causing harm for the sake of causing harm and for other purposes.

That is, someone who causes harm and gets enjoyment out of it is still causing harm for the sake of causing harm. However, someone who gets angry and wants to hurt others for the sake of hurting them is also acting in an evil manner.

However, this also means that greed is not evil, because it is not to cause harm, but to profit.
